Michael Hakes - CFA, MBAFisker Inc.FSRDON'T BUYDec 15, 2021

Super-speculative EV play. 18,000 confirmed orders for its new truck that's launching next year. Whereas GM makes 18,000 vehicles a day. Price to forward sales (28x) is more expensive than Tesla (14x), while GM is 0.5x. We'll be awash in EVs. Winter is coming for EV startups.

TOP PICK

Stockchase Research Editor: Michael O'Reilly Our TOP PICK recommendation with FSR, it a bit more speculative than our normal picks. However, its time might be here as a potential disruptor in the EV space. The original Fisker Automotive company went bankrupt in 2012, but has reemerged focusing solely on EV. They plan to release a SUV in 2022 with a 300 mile range with a solar panel roof to extend that. Priced around $30,000 USD (after EV credits), it could seriously challenge Tesla. We would buy this with a $11 stop-loss, looking to achieve $21.00 -- 35% upside potential. Yield 0% (Analysts’ price target is $21.00)
